Is it possible to trigger fzf history search automatically in zsh shell?

In this video, the user clicks "Ctrl+r" to start the history search and then starts typing. Is it possible to start the history search automatically when I start typing anything? Alternatively, is it possible to configure zsh so that a new prompt always starts in the "Ctrl+r" mode?

You cannot start Fzf automatically when you type something. Else, you wouldn’t be able to ever return to your command line, since Fzf would then intercept all of your keystrokes.

However, my zsh-autocomplete plugin can be configured to automatically show matching history items, without leaving the command line. Install the plugin and, additionally, add this setting to your .zshrc file:

zstyle ':autocomplete:*' default-context history-incremental-search-backward

history autocompletion screen recording

Press CtrlR to toggle between history and completions.
